paugnu / module-deepl
DeepL API 的 Magento 2 翻译扩展
Requires
- php: ~8.0.0|~8.1.0|~8.2.0|~8.3.0
- magento/magento-composer-installer: *
- magento/module-catalog: *
This package is auto-updated.
Last update: 2024-09-04 04:42:09 UTC
README
此 Magento 2 模块通过 DeepL API 扩展了您的商店,允许自动翻译 CMS 页面、CMS 块、产品、属性、评分和分类。
需要 DeepL API 密钥,可以在 这里 创建
免费 DEEPL API 密钥 + 每月 500,000 个字
您可以在 这里 注册新的 Deepl Free API
当前支持的语言
- BG - 保加利亚语
- CS - 捷克语
- DA - 丹麦语
- DE - 德语
- EL - 希腊语
- EN - 英语
- ES - 西班牙语
- ET - 爱沙尼亚语
- FI - 芬兰语
- FR - 法语
- HU - 匈牙利语
- ID - 印度尼西亚语
- IT - 意大利语
- JA - 日语
- KO - 韩语
- LT - 立陶宛语
- LV - 拉脱维亚语
- NB - 挪威语(博克马尔语)
- NL - 荷兰语
- PL - 波兰语
- PT - 葡萄牙语(所有葡萄牙语变体混合)
- RO - 罗马尼亚语
- RU - 俄语
- SK - 斯洛伐克语
- SL - 斯洛文尼亚语
- SV - 瑞典语
- TR - 土耳其语
- UK - 乌克兰语
- ZH - 中文
安装
要求
Magento CE > 2.2.5
Composer
转到 Magento 2 根目录并作为 web 用户(通常是 www-data)执行以下命令。
composer config repositories.aromicon_deepl vcs git@github.com:aromicon/magento2-deepl.git
composer require aromicon/module-deepl
bin/magento module:enable Aromicon_Deepl
bin/magento setup:upgrade
bin/magento setup:di:compile
bin/magento cache:enable (only needed, if caches were enabled before)
手动(不推荐)
转到您的 Magento 2 根目录并创建一个名为 app/code/Aromicon/Deepl 的文件夹。将存档提取到该文件夹中,并作为 web 用户(通常是 www-data)执行以下命令。
bin/magento module:enable Aromicon_Deepl
bin/magento setup:upgrade
bin/magento setup:di:compile
bin/magento cache:enable (only needed, if caches were enabled before)
Magento 2 配置
可以在 商店 > 配置 > Aromicon > Deepl 翻译
下找到 Aromicon Deepl 翻译配置。
首先,您需要指定默认商店视图,这是您通常添加内容并使用默认语言的商店视图。
其次,您需要根据您的账户选择 API 版本。您可以选择 "免费" 或 "专业版"。
第三,您需要输入由 DeepL Pro 提供的 API 密钥。
您还可以配置默认翻译哪些字段,包括 CMS 页面、产品和分类。
用法
所有翻译将按商店视图添加。目标语言将从商店视图的区域设置中接收。
翻译 Magento 2 CMS 块
转到 内容 > CMS > 块
,打开要翻译的块。在右上角的编辑表单中,将出现一个新的翻译按钮。选择块应翻译和复制的商店视图。默认情况下,块将被复制到所选商店视图,并翻译标题和内容。
翻译 CMS 页面
转到 内容 > CMS > 页面
,打开要翻译的页面。在右上角的编辑表单中,将出现一个新的翻译按钮。选择块应翻译和复制的商店视图。默认情况下,页面将被复制到所选商店视图,并翻译标题、URL 键、元信息和内容。
翻译属性
所有 Magento 2 属性都可以进行翻译,但只有商店标签会被翻译。如果属性是下拉列表或多选属性,且没有自定义源模型,则选项值也会被翻译。
转到 商店 > 属性 > 产品
并选择所需的属性。使用右上角顶部的翻译按钮。
翻译 Magento 2 分类
在分类中,名称、页面标题、内容、URL 键和元信息将进行翻译。如果您打开一个分类,您将在右上角看到翻译按钮。翻译后的内容将被复制到所选的商店视图。
翻译产品
默认情况下,名称、简短描述、描述、URL 键和元信息将进行翻译。您还可以配置所有类型为文本或文本区域的属性以进行翻译。只需转到您的产品编辑视图,然后为所需的商店视图点击翻译按钮。翻译后的数据将被复制到所选的商店视图。
翻译产品评论
产品评论也可以进行翻译。只需转到 营销 > 用户内容 > 评论
并打开一个评论,然后从翻译按钮中选择一个商店视图。
Aromicon Deepl Pro
您正在寻找从后端或控制台进行批量翻译?试试我们的 Aromicon Translate Pro Magento 2 模块
支持
拉取请求、问题和特性始终欢迎。
我们 ❤ Magento。由 [aromicon](https://www.aromicon.de) 提供
由 [aromicon](https://www.aromicon.de) 制作